The company says this update makes compatible cars a better entertainment hub and a smarter workspace.

Mercedes-Benz has begun rolling out a free over-the-air update for its MBUX car operating system. Over 700,000 cars currently on the road around the world will be able to receive the update. Models that run on the third-generation software platform include the current Mercedes-Benz GLC, C-Class, CLE, and E-Class. Availability and exact features might vary between countries and territories, as well as individual car configuration and capabilities. 

The company is touting more immersive entertainment for owners of compatible cars. In terms of audio, Dolby Atmos is now supported in the Amazon Music, Audible, and Tidal apps, while the IMAX Enhanced video format with DTS:X sound will be available in the Ridevu by Sony Pictures app. This brings spatial audio and video to the in-car infotainment system, so passengers can have a more cinematic experience while on the go. 

In addition to video content, music and audiobooks, the update also adds new features for gaming. A new Gamepack includes a selection of popular retro-style mini-games that passengers can play at any time.

Mercedes-Benz owners in Germany, the UK, France, Italy, Spain, the USA and Japan who do not already use Amazon Music Unlimited can claim a three-month trial subscription, while those in Belgium, France, Germany, Italy, Japan, Luxembourg, Spain, the UK, and the USA can also get two months of Audible Premium. Both offers can be claimed any time before the end of 2026, though they will auto-renew unless cancelled manually. 

Productivity also gets a boost with calendar integration, allowing car owners to see their upcoming appointments through the MBUX interface. The new app works with the same data as the user’s MBUX Notes, and will soon also integrate with MBUX Meetings. Location data in a calendar appointment can be used to quickly set a route for navigation. Drivers can also initiate a Microsoft Teams call directly through the app.

The improved MBUX voice assistant allows for additional functions such as adjusting car settings. Users can also ask the car to read out an overview of their upcoming appointments
